WHAT I LIVE FOR.
I liyb for thoie who love me, Whose hearts are kind and true ; For the heaven that smiles above me, And awaits my spirit, too ; For all human ties that bind me, For tbe task by God assigned me, For the bright hopes yet to find me ; And tbe good that I can do. I live to learn their story Wbo suffered for my sake, To emulate their glory, And follow in their wake ; Bards, patriots, martyrs, sages, The heroic of all ages, Wbose deeds crowd History's pages And Timt'd great volume make. I live to bold communion With all that is divine ; To feel there is a nnion Twixt Nature's heart and mine. To profit by affliction, Beap truth from fields of fiction, Grow wiser from conviction, And fulfil God's grand design. I live to bail tbe season By gifted ones foretold, When men shall live by reason, And not alone by gold — When man to man united, And every wrong thing righted. Tbe whole world shall be lighted, As Eden was of old, I live for those wbo love me, For those who love ms true ; For the heaven that smiles above me, And awaits my spirit too ; For the cause that lacks assistance, For the wrong that needs resistance, For the future in the distance And the good that I can do.
